Transaction b3a70802a6812578e4a53a39d26f3289c532472619e68bc05a3b100b558585d7
1 Input
1 Output
-
b3a70802a6812578e4a53a39d26f3289c532472619e68bc05a3b100b558585d7:0
- value
- 674896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 177606e56d9971739774b2d9e41bc85b66739a1b OP_EQUAL
- address
- 33q4rcQeL3VAMLBA7RJdhRbUajjEZ35ndT